?     Asked on 6/8/2017by Norman

My pool area is 288 sq ft. So I only need 4 4x10 panels. Is that correct? What would be the benefits of having more than 4 panels? If I put in 6 or 7 panels, would my pool be kept at a warmer temperature?
 Reply

A  Answered on 6/11/2017 by InyoPools Product Specialist Lennox H.

Hi, Norman. A pool with a 288 sq. ft requires 5 panels, the kit is p/n AQI2P4X105

?     Asked on 3/17/2019by Angel

What else would I need to install ?
 Reply

A  Answered on 3/17/2019 by InyoPools Product Specialist Lennox H.

Hi, Angel. You will need (1) 2" System Kit - AQI121352, and 2" Panel Installation Kit - AQI120342. If you're installing multiple panels see our 4' x 10' Solar Panels Packages which will include all the components for installation.
